WILKES-BARRE, Pa. – The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ins announced today that they have signed goaltender Tommy Nappier to a three-year, American Hockey League contract beginning in the 2020-21 season.

Nappier, 22, had one of the most prolific goaltending careers in Ohio State University men’s hockey history. In 2018-19, he was named Big Ten Goalie of the Year after leading the conference with a .934 save percentage, 1.86 goals against average and four shutouts. His 1.86 goals against average also established a new single-season program record. One year later, Nappier was voted the Buckeyes’ Team MVP after placing second in the Big Ten in save percentage (.932), goals against average (2.04) and wins (17).

At the end of his four years at Ohio State, Nappier ranks third all-time in Buckeyes history with a .925 career save percentage, fourth in career shutouts (8) and fifth in career goals against average (2.31).

The native of St. Louis, Missouri is coming off his senior season with Ohio State, during which he placed second in the nation with 700 total saves. During the 2020-21 campaign, Nappier recorded a 7-16-1 record, 3.28 goals against average and .906 save percentage with the Buckeyes.

Nappier had also previously attended Pittsburgh Penguins Development Camp in 2018.
